Amanda Cimaglia
Managing Director, ESG
Solebury Trout
Amanda currently leads Solebury Trout’s ESG practice, which guides companies on ESG strategies that create long-term value and drive stakeholder engagement, encompassing both investor relations and corporate communications initiatives. Amanda works closely with management teams and boards to create, improve and communicate strong ESG practices that can reduce risk and create opportunities, leveraging her practical investor relations, corporate communications and ESG expertise.
Prior to joining Solebury Trout, Amanda most recently served as Assistant Vice President, Investor Relations & ESG Reporting at Hannon Armstrong (NYSE: HASI), a leading investor in climate change solutions. She joined Hannon Armstrong in 2012, prior to its initial public offering, and was responsible for the development and execution of the company’s investor relations strategy as well as creating and implementing ESG-related strategies, policies and communications. This resulted in a significant increase in ownership by ESG-oriented investors and broad recognition of Hannon Armstrong’s ESG leadership in the public capital markets. During her seven-year tenure at Hannon Armstrong, Amanda participated in raising over $1 billion in the public capital markets. Notably, she built an award-winning investor relations program, garnering the 2019 Best Overall Investor Relations (Small Cap) Award and was a finalist for Best ESG Reporting at the IR Magazine 2019 U.S. Awards. She was also a finalist for the 2018 Rising Star of Investor Relations award.
Amanda holds a bachelor of business administration, cum laude, from Loyola University Maryland and a master of science in investor relations from Fordham University. She has served as a member of the ESG working groups for both the American Council on Renewable Energy (ACORE) and the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E).
